Initially, using an 'and' clause raised a TypeError when passing in a non-subscriptable data type; hence, the desired Exception was not raised. Due to the usage of 'or' clause in other '.from_' methods, it only checked the datatype and did not check the subscriptable nature, and raised the correct Exception. The image below demonstrates it.
